• 关于我们
  • 产品
  • 交易
  • 数字货币
Sign in Get Started
            
                

            开发以太坊钱包应用的指南与最佳实践2026-01-07 13:52:16

            ## 内容主体大纲 1. **引言** - 以太坊及其重要性 - 钱包应用在区块链中的角色 2. **以太坊基础知识** - 什么是以太坊 - 以太坊的工作原理 3. **钱包应用类型** - 热钱包与冷钱包的比较 - 常见的以太坊钱包应用 4. **开发以太坊钱包应用的步骤** - 环境准备 - 选择适当的开发工具 - 编写及测试智能合约 5. **用户界面设计** - 钱包应用的用户体验设计要点 - 常见界面功能及设计建议 6. **安全性考虑** - 安全性在钱包应用中的重要性 - 常见的安全风险与防范措施 7. **测试与部署** - 钱包应用的测试策略 - 部署钱包应用的步骤 8. **未来的发展趋势** - 钱包应用的发展方向 - 以太坊生态的未来 9. **总结** - 本文的核心要点 ## 引言 在数字货币快速发展的时代,以太坊作为最受欢迎的智能合约平台之一,吸引了无数的开发者和投资者。钱包应用是连接用户与区块链的桥梁,其重要性不言而喻。本文将为您提供开发以太坊钱包应用的全面指南,包括基础知识、开发步骤、设计考虑及未来趋势。 ## 1. 以太坊基础知识 ### 什么是以太坊 以太坊是一个开源的区块链平台,允许开发者构建和部署智能合约和去中心化应用(DApp)。与比特币主要用于价值转移不同,以太坊能够承载复杂的逻辑运算。 ### 以太坊的工作原理 以太坊基于一种称为“以太坊虚拟机”(EVM)的技术,使得开发者能够在区块链上执行代码。用户通过以太坊网络进行交易和交互,而每个交易都需要消耗以太币(ETH)作为交易手续费。 ## 2. 钱包应用类型 ### 热钱包与冷钱包的比较 热钱包是指始终连接到互联网的钱包,通常用于频繁交易。冷钱包则是离线存储的方式,更为安全,适合用于长期保存资产。热钱包便捷,但安全性较低;冷钱包安全但使用不便。 ### 常见的以太坊钱包应用 目前市场上存在多种以太坊钱包应用,从软件钱包(如MetaMask)到硬件钱包(如Ledger和Trezor),各有优缺点。 ## 3. 开发以太坊钱包应用的步骤 ### 环境准备 开发以太坊钱包应用首先需要设置开发环境。这通常包括Node.js、Truffle、Ganache等工具。 ### 选择适当的开发工具 选择合适的库和工具是成功的关键。例如,Web3.js和Ethers.js都是与以太坊交互的流行库,能够简化开发过程。 ### 编写及测试智能合约 智能合约是钱包应用的核心部分。使用Solidity语言编写合约,并通过固化的测试确保合约逻辑的正确性是至关重要的。 ## 4. 用户界面设计 ### 钱包应用的用户体验设计要点 用户友好的界面能够提升用户的使用体验。设计应当简单直观,确保用户易于理解和操作。 ### 常见界面功能及设计建议 包括余额查询、交易记录、发送/接收功能等,保持设计的一致性和响应性也是关键。 ## 5. 安全性考虑 ### 安全性在钱包应用中的重要性 钱包应用涉及用户的资产,因此安全性非常关键,必须认真对待。 ### 常见的安全风险与防范措施 包括数据泄露、钓鱼攻击、私钥管理等,开发者应通过加密技术、定期审计和多重验证等方法提高应用的安全性。 ## 6. 测试与部署 ### 钱包应用的测试策略 通过单元测试、集成测试和用户测试,确保钱包应用的功能完整且安全无虞。 ### 部署钱包应用的步骤 一旦测试完成,开发者可以将钱包应用部署到主网或测试网。建议在正式上线前进行多次试运行。 ## 7. 未来的发展趋势 ### 钱包应用的发展方向 随着Web3的兴起,钱包应用将越来越多地融入去中心化金融(DeFi)、非同质化代币(NFT)等新兴领域。 ### 以太坊生态的未来 以太坊2.0的到来将极大地改善网络性能,这对钱包应用的发展也会带来积极的影响。 ## 8. 总结 本文介绍了开发以太坊钱包应用的基础知识与最佳实践,涵盖了从环境准备、设计安全到未来趋势的各个环节。希望能为希望进入区块链领域的开发者们提供有价值的参考。 ## 相关问题 ### 以太坊钱包应用的发展现状如何? ####

            当前的市场状况

            目前,以太坊钱包应用已经成为区块链行业的一部分,随着DeFi和NFT的兴起,用户对以太坊钱包的需求不断增长。各种新兴的应用使得数字资产的管理变得越来越便捷。

            ####

            使用量的增长

            根据数据显示,越来越多的人开始使用以太坊钱包来参与数字资产交易。许多用户由于对ETH的关注而积极下载和使用以太坊钱包。

            ####

            竞争环境

            市面上存在众多以太坊钱包应用,它们在功能和安全性上竞争激烈。开发者需要不断创新以吸引用户。

            ### 如何选择适合的以太坊钱包? ####

            考虑的因素

            选择以太坊钱包时,用户需考虑安全性、易用性以及功能。热钱包适合频繁交易,而冷钱包则适合长期存储。

            ####

            推荐的钱包类型

            对于新手,MetaMask是个不错的选择,易于使用且功能齐全;对于大额资产,建议使用硬件钱包如Ledger或Trezor。

            ####

            社区反馈

            用户可以通过论坛、社交媒体等渠道了解其他用户对于不同钱包的反馈,选择信誉良好的产品。

            ### 如何确保以太坊钱包的安全性? ####

            安全措施

            保护私钥的安全是至关重要的。用户需确保私钥不与他人分享,并保存在安全的地方。

            ####

            防钓鱼攻击

            开发者需频繁更新钱包应用,以避免漏洞被利用。用户也需保持警惕,不要随便点击不明链接。

            ####

            使用双重认证

            建议使用双重认证等附加安全措施,增强用户账户的安全性,防止未授权访问。

            ### 钱包应用如何与其他DApp集成? ####

            API接口的使用

            开发者可以通过钱包的API接口实现与其他去中心化应用的集成,这能为用户提供无缝的体验。

            ####

            智能合约的交互

            钱包应用与智能合约的交互在于能够执行交易和确认用户的身份,确保用户的资金安全。

            ####

            示例应用

            诸如Uniswap和OpenSea等知名平台,均与以太坊钱包应用实现了良好的兼容性,提升了用户体验。

            ### 以太坊2.0对钱包应用的影响是什么? ####

            网络性能的提升

            以太坊2.0将引入权益证明机制,减少能源消耗,提高交易处理速度,这将直接影响钱包应用的用户体验。

            ####

            费用降低

            网络的扩展性将使得交易费用降低,更有利于小额交易用户使用以太坊钱包。

            ####

            新功能的出现

            随着以太坊网络的升级,钱包应用也会随之推出新的功能,例如支持新的代币标准等。

            ### 未来钱包应用可能面临的挑战是什么? ####

            竞争加剧

            随着市场的扩大,钱包应用的竞争将更加激烈。新兴技术和产品会不断推出,给现有钱包带来压力。

            ####

            用户教育

            对于区块链技术的知识仍为普及,许多用户并不理解如何安全使用钱包应用,因此用户教育变得越来越重要。

            ####

            合规性问题

            各国对于数字货币的监管政策不同,这对以太坊钱包的开发和运营是一大挑战。

            以上的内容只是大纲的基础部分,每个部分都可以进一步细化和扩展,以满足整体字数和内容的丰富度。

            注册我们的时事通讯

            我们的进步

            本周热门

            以太坊钱包同步失败的原
            以太坊钱包同步失败的原
            比特币钱包使用中的常见
            比特币钱包使用中的常见
            : 如何通过Qki钱包快速提币
            : 如何通过Qki钱包快速提币
            区块链钱包创建界面详解
            区块链钱包创建界面详解
            区块链钱包增益:了解数
            区块链钱包增益:了解数
            
                    

              地址

              Address : 1234 lock, Charlotte, North Carolina, United States

              Phone : +12 534894364

              Email : info@example.com

              Fax : +12 534894364

              快速链接

              • 关于我们
              • 产品
              • 交易
              • 数字货币
              • 小狐钱包app官方网站
              • 小狐钱包官方下载app

              通讯

              通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

              小狐钱包app官方网站

              小狐钱包app官方网站是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
              我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,小狐钱包app官方网站都是您信赖的选择。

              • facebook
              • twitter
              • google
              • linkedin

              2003-2025 小狐钱包app官方网站 @版权所有 |网站地图|桂ICP备2022008651号-1

                              Login Now
                              We'll never share your email with anyone else.

                              Don't have an account?

                                        Register Now

                                        By clicking Register, I agree to your terms